The Full Time Biomedical Signal Processing Engineer primarily focuses on developing and optimizing algorithms for biomedical signals like ECG or EEG, working closely with hardware and device development. In contrast, the Biomedical Data Analyst interprets biomedical data to generate insights, often using statistical tools. Both roles require strong analytical skills but differ in their focus on signal processing versus data interpretation.
